But this isn’t just about having fun. Young’s has partnered with Wooden Spoon, rugby’s children’s charity, to raise funds for The Clink Charity.

The Clink provides people in prison with the opportunity to gain new skills, qualifications and valuable experience in catering and horticulture. Students train in a professional working environment while working towards recognised City & Guilds qualifications, helping them build the skills and confidence they need for life after prison.

The Clink also supports students with practical things such as securing accommodation upon release, giving them a genuine opportunity to return to their communities, turn their lives around and ultimately reduce reoffending and improve public safety.
